Our process includes detailed roof inspection (core sampling where required), high-pressure washing (3000 psi) to remove dirt, salts, and efflorescence, crack and spall repair with polymer mortar, joint sealing with polyurethane sealants, priming with compatible sealers, main waterproofing application (torch-applied APP/SBS bituminous membranes 4–5 mm thick, liquid-applied polyurethane/silicone/acrylic 1.5–3 mm DFT, or single-ply TPO/PVC mechanically fixed or adhered), detailing at upstands, penetrations, drains, and terminations (150–300 mm height), flood testing (25–50 mm ponding for 24–48 hours), thermal imaging verification of trapped moisture, and final topcoat application where exposed (reflective SRI >100).

The equipment fleet includes high-pressure washers, airless spray rigs (Graco), torch kits, flood-test dams, thermal imaging cameras (FLIR), adhesion testers, and thickness gauges.
Principal risks mitigated include blistering (prevented via proper priming and venting), UV degradation (addressed with aliphatic topcoats), ponding (ensured through positive slope, tapered insulation, or crickets), and wind uplift (countered with mechanical fastening or ballast in inverted systems).
